For this table, I am using my new method for enabling/disabling the dB2S backglass. By default the backglass is disabled. The easy way to enable it is this method:
1.Launch table and then exit. It will auto-create a file in the USER folder of VPinball named "LMEMTables.txt"
2.Open this file in notepad and change the "0" to a "1" and save.
3.Next time you launch, the backglass will launch.
Or for the die hards out there, create a text file in the USER folder named LMEMTables.txt and put a "1" (no quotes) on the first line and save it.
 
Operator menu options are as follows:
"[" - open/close the operator menu
"6" - changes balls per game (3/5)
"7" - change replay settings - but for now I only have 1 set of replay settings so you can't change these.
On the full screen version, pay attention to the apron to tell whether it is set for 3 or 5 ball play.
